Practice acceptance and compassion towards yourself and others from "summary" of The Happiness Trap Pocketbook by Dr Russ Harris,Russ Harris,Bev Aisbett

To truly cultivate a sense of contentment and peace in our lives, it is essential to embrace the practice of acceptance and compassion towards both ourselves and others. This involves acknowledging and making peace with our own imperfections, limitations, and struggles, as well as extending understanding and kindness to those around us who may also be navigating their own challenges and difficulties. When we practice acceptance towards ourselves, we are essentially choosing to let go of the constant self-criticism, judgment, and comparison that often plague our minds. Instead of getting caught up in a cycle of negative self-talk and unrealistic expectations, we learn to treat ourselves with greater kindness, patience, and understanding. This allows us to embrace our flaws and vulnerabilities as part of what makes us human, rather than seeing them as failures or shortcomings. Similarly, when we extend compassion towards others, we are able to foster deeper connections, empathy, and understanding in our relationships. By recognizing that everyone is fighting their own battles and facing their own obstacles, we can approach interactions with a greater sense of empathy, tolerance, and kindness. This not only strengthens our relationships and fosters a sense of community and connection but also allows us to cultivate a more positive and harmonious environment in which everyone feels seen, heard, and valued.
  1. Practicing acceptance and compassion towards ourselves and others is not about striving for perfection or denying the reality of our challenges and struggles. Instead, it is about embracing the messy, imperfect, and unpredictable nature of life with an open heart and a gentle spirit. By choosing to approach ourselves and others with acceptance and compassion, we can create a more peaceful, fulfilling, and meaningful existence for ourselves and those around us.
